Analyzing the warehouse layout design of a manufacturing, service, or distribution company involves understanding how efficiently space is used within the facility to facilitate the movement of products, money, and people. Efficient warehouse layout is crucial for optimizing inventory management and control systems. The design should consider the handling of key natural resources, component flow, ease of access for workers, and the use of space for storage equipment.
Warehouse layout design can be analyzed by evaluating how the floor space is allocated for different processes such as receiving, storage, picking, packing, and shipping. The design should allow for smooth and logical flow of materials, minimize handling, and facilitate efficient inventory control. Moreover, it could adapt just-in-time principles or incorporate automation to reduce waste and improve speed.
Recommendations for improving the system might include better integration of technology to track inventory, reorganization of the warehouse to align with the most frequent and logical movement patterns, or implementing advanced systems such as automated storage and retrieval systems (ASRS).
